This is a Full Time Day shift position. Hours are 7:30 am – 4:30 pm Monday–Friday.
As an Infection Prevention Coordinator RN, you will assist with the coordination of all aspects of the facility infection prevention and control program. You will be directly involved with activities directed toward prevention and control of healthcare‑associated infections and will serve as an infection prevention and control consultant for facility staff, patients, and the community. You will interact with physicians, outside agencies, corporate/divisional staff as well as all departments within the facility.
Qualifications- Graduate of an accredited school of Professional Nursing
- BSN is required within 24 months of hire
- Current RN license in the State of TX or compact license
- Minimum of 3 years current clinical experience in an acute care hospital required; 5 years preferred
- 1–2 years experience in Infection Prevention and Control preferred
- Experience with quality and process improvement background
- Certification by the National Certification Board of Infection Control and Applied Epidemiology preferred
- Strong interpersonal communication skills in both written and verbal format
- Strong computer skills
